Tottenham v Bodo/Glimt match preview

The potentially defining home match of Tottenham’s curious season arrives on Thursday when Ange Postecoglou’s side take on Bodo/Glimt in the first leg of the Europa League semi-finals.

Spurs suffered their third successive Premier League defeat with a 5-1 thrashing at champions Liverpool on Sunday, taking their total to 19 league losses in a season that still holds the promise of silverware if they can oust the reigning Norwegian champions and beat Manchester United or Athletic Bilbao in the final.

“I don’t think so,” Postecoglou replied when he was asked if he will need to lift his players after their troubles at Anfield. “We had some key players missing who I think will come in and sort of make sure there isn’t any hangover.

“We had a really young midfield with Lucas [Bergvall] and Archie [Gray] and you’re asking a massive task of them. It was always going to be a huge ask for us and it proved too much.”

Bodo/Glimt beat Lazio on penalties in the last eight, becoming the first Norwegian team to reach the semi-finals of a European competition.

“I don’t believe in miracles,” manager Kjetil Knutsen said afterwards. “I believe in our journey. The magic was with us. We played an extraordinary match and we’re incredibly proud to be in the semi-finals.”

Forward Jens Petter Hauge called Glimt’s progress “crazy”. “Everything is possible now,” he added. “There are four teams left and we have to keep working hard to prepare for Tottenham.

“They are a strong team with many good players. It’s going to be tough – like [against Lazio] – but this group can do it and we believe in ourselves.”

Tottenham v Bodo/Glimt team news

As Postecoglou’s remarks suggest, Spurs are likely to make wholesale changes for a match they have clearly been prioritising since advancing with an impressive 2-1 aggregate win over Eintracht Frankfurt.

“A lot of our players have missed a lot of this season with injuries and it [is about] managing their minutes, because we want them ready,” the Australian told Tottenham’s website.

“Guys like Micky [van de ven] and [Cristian] Romero could have played [on Sunday], but they’ve missed so much of the season that we’ve just got to be really careful about when we use them.

“Guys like Pedro [Porro] and [Rodrigo] Bentancur have played a lot this year.”

Defender Radu Dragusin is out with a knee injury and Heung-Min Son is “touch and go” because of a foot issue, with the forward likely to be ready for the second leg, according to Postecoglou.

Bodo/Glimt have problems of their own. Forward Andreas Helmersen and midfielders Hakon Evjen and Patrick Berg are suspended, while winger Ole Didrik Blomberg and centre-back Odin Bjortuft are injury doubts.

Bjortuft has played throughout much of their European campaign but was forced off through injury during their 3-0 home win over KFUM on Sunday.

“He was disappointed and told me that he his groin was painful, but you can feel pain without that necessarily meaning it is something [bad],” teammate Ulrik Saltnes was quoted as saying by Football London.

“I do not know anything,” Knutsen reportedly said. “I never enjoy a player laying down, but the medical staff are looking into it.”

Spurs v Bodo/Glimt expected line-ups

Tottenham starting XI: Vicario; Pedro Porro, Romero, Van de Ven, Udogie; Bergvall, Bentancur, Maddison; Kulusevski, Solanke, Tel

Bodo/Glimt starting XI: Haikin; Sjovold, Bjortuft, Gundersen, Bjorkan; Moe, Brunstad Fet, Saltnes; Blomberg, Hogh, Hauge
